Why a safety management system, and why here
Most organisations arrive at ISO 45001 through a customer requirement or an insurance conversation. In Louisville there is a more direct route, and it is worth being plain about it.
On 12 November 2024, a batch reactor at the Givaudan Sense Colour plant ruptured. Two people were killed and two seriously injured. A section of the pressure vessel was ejected beyond the fence line and struck a residential building. The US Chemical Safety Board released its final report on 27 May 2026.
The CSB found the facility lacked adequate process safety management systems to identify and control reactivity hazards, and that operators had not been trained on safe operating limits or on what happened if decomposition temperature thresholds were exceeded. Reporting also established that a cooking vessel had overpressurised at the same site roughly a year earlier.
That is a management system failure described in the vocabulary of a management system standard. Hazard identification that did not identify the hazard. Competence requirements that did not produce competence. An incident that did not generate the investigation that would have prevented the next one. ISO 45001 does not guarantee any of those things happen — but it is the framework that asks the questions.

Rubbertown, and the regulator that grew up around it
Louisville Metro Air Pollution Control District names twenty Rubbertown facilities, including Carbide Industries, The Chemours Company, DuPont Specialty Products, Zeon Chemicals, American Synthetic Rubber, Lubrizol, PolyOne, Bakelite Synthetics and Eckart America, alongside several fuel terminals.
The District's STAR programme — Strategic Toxic Air Reduction, adopted in 2005 — is among the more demanding local air toxics regimes in the country. The District reports toxic air emissions down roughly 80% and Category 1 toxins down roughly 96% since. A Rubbertown Air Toxics and Health Assessment is currently underway with EPA grant funding.
For operators in the corridor that produces an unusual compliance shape: a local air regulator with real teeth sitting alongside a state OSHA plan. An integrated ISO 14001 and ISO 45001 system is often less work here than running the two separately, because the hazard analysis underneath them substantially overlaps.
Kentucky runs its own OSHA plan — get the attribution right
Kentucky operates an OSHA-approved State Plan, administered by the Kentucky Education and Labor Cabinet's Department of Workplace Standards in Frankfort. It covers private sector and state and local government employees.
A 13-member Standards Board adopts standards. Some are federal OSHA standards taken unchanged, some are federal standards with Kentucky-specific provisions, and some are unique to Kentucky — with machinery guarding, bloodborne pathogens, fall protection and hazardous substances among the areas addressed.
This matters practically. When you read that Carbide Industries was fined $7,000 in February 2025 for hazardous energy control violations, or $11,200 after the 2011 explosion that killed two workers, those are Kentucky OSH actions rather than federal OSHA ones. Consultants who describe them as OSHA fines are telling a Louisville safety manager something about how well they know the jurisdiction.
Ford is currently demonstrating the top of the hierarchy of controls
Ford is executing a $2 billion overhaul of its roughly 3-million-square-foot Louisville Assembly Plant to build a midsize electric truck on its Universal EV Production System, with prototype builds expected in early 2027.
What makes it relevant here is that Ford has published the ergonomics. Building the vehicle in three sections assembled simultaneously produces an 84% reduction in workers reaching over fenders. Large aluminium castings replace dozens of stamped and welded parts. The wiring harness is over 4,000 feet shorter and 22 pounds lighter.
That is elimination and engineering control — the top of the hierarchy — quantified by a named local employer in public. It is a more persuasive argument for designing hazards out than anything a consultant can say, and it is happening at the largest manufacturing site in the metro.
Worldport, and the scale of the logistics hazard
UPS Worldport employs around 20,000 people, processes roughly two million packages a day at up to 416,000 an hour at peak, and handles more than 300 flights daily. UPS is the largest employer in the Louisville area.
An operation at that scale generates a supplier and contractor ecosystem around it — ground handling, maintenance, freight, warehousing — where the hazard profile is manual handling, powered industrial trucks, working at height and vehicle movement rather than process chemistry.
It is worth noting the other side too: UPS said in January 2026 that it expects to cut around 30,000 further positions during the year as part of its Amazon volume reduction. How many of those fall on Louisville has not been published, and we are not going to guess at it.

Questions we get from companies in this market
Is ISO 45001 the same as an OSHA compliance programme?
No, and conflating them is a common and expensive mistake. Kentucky OSH sets the legal floor: specific requirements you must meet, enforced by inspection and citation. ISO 45001 is a management system standard — it asks whether you have a systematic way of identifying hazards, controlling them, involving workers and improving. You can be fully OSHA-compliant and have no management system, which is roughly the situation the CSB described at Givaudan.
We're a Rubbertown operator with process safety management already. Does ISO 45001 add anything?
It can, and the honest answer depends on what your PSM programme covers. PSM is oriented to catastrophic release scenarios. ISO 45001 covers the whole occupational health and safety picture, including the routine manual handling and vehicle movement injuries that produce most lost time. Where it adds most is the management-system scaffolding — worker participation, competence, incident investigation feeding back into hazard assessment — which PSM programmes often assume rather than require.
Does Kentucky's state plan change what certification looks like?
Not the certification itself, which is against the international standard. It changes what your legal and other requirements register has to contain, and it changes who inspects you. Kentucky OSH adopts some standards unchanged from federal OSHA, some with state-specific provisions, and maintains some unique to Kentucky. A compliance obligations register built from federal OSHA alone will be incomplete here.
Can ISO 45001 be built alongside ISO 14001 or ISO 9001?
Usually yes, and for a chemical or heavy manufacturing operation it is frequently the cheaper route. All three share the harmonized structure, so clauses 4 through 10 are substantially common — context, leadership, competence, documented information, internal audit, management review and improvement. The hazard analysis under 45001 and the aspects analysis under 14001 also overlap heavily. A combined build and a combined audit can be materially less work than two projects.
How long does ISO 45001 take?
For a mid-sized manufacturer with an existing safety programme, six to nine months to a certifiable system is realistic. For an operation starting from compliance-only with no systematic hazard assessment, longer — and the honest constraint is usually the hazard identification work rather than the documentation, because it has to be done properly and it has to involve the workforce.
What will it cost?
Certification body audit days are set against the number of people within your certification scope using a published table, then adjusted for factors including site count and sector risk. We show that arithmetic rather than quoting a number before scope exists. The certification cost breakdown sets out the table and the adjustment factors so you can check any quote you receive.
